I was in a very similar incident a couple years ago, on a much smaller scale, but the First 30 that hit us has a fairly plumb bow so it didn't ride up like the J Boat with the long overhang. Just like that video we were on starboard heading into the windward mark and the port tack boat tried to duck. They told us after the main sheet got stuck, the helm loaded up and he could not bear away. Here is the damage to the First 40 I was on at the time, I was trimming the jib at the forward winch and saw him coming so ran to the high side, just like the guy that got knocked over on the J did.
